May 22 dryline near Homestead
File Times height AGL antenna
position obs F1 2206-2212 1400
m down multiple humidity jumps, even at 1400 m
nice echo plumes F2.1 2220-2225 600 m up 2
dryline plumes emerge from a series of
q-discontinuities F2.2 2242-2248 200
m up single dryline, tilting to the W as if
propagating like a density current F3.1
2324-2330 1400 m down 2 drylines, the E one
is best defined - we can try dual-Doppler F3.2
2333-2339 800 m down 2 drylines, retreating
W and diverging from each other F4
2344-2352 200 m up 2 well-defined drylines,
retreating westward, esp the western one
